首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>如何增加中间值mysql

如何增加中间值mysql
EN

Stack Overflow用户
提问于 2017-04-01 21:17:09
回答 1查看 145关注 0票数 0

我正在尝试在下面的查询中添加一个中位数。我已经为Sales_Total_Price列提供了Sales_Total_Price的MIN和Item_name的结果组。

有人能帮我吗。我见过很多关于这方面的文章,但是我很难将这些数据附加到我的查询中。谢谢!

代码语言:javascript
复制
SELECT item_master_list.Item_Name, item_master_list.NPC_Item_Price,
       item_master_list.NPC_Item_Value,   
       MAX(public_vendor_sales_data.Sales_Total_Price),    
       MIN(public_vendor_sales_data.Sales_Total_Price)
FROM item_master_list INNER JOIN
     public_vendor_sales_data
     ON  public_vendor_sales_data.Item_ID = item_master_list.Item_ID
GROUP BY Item_Name

当前结果结果

EN

回答 1

Stack Overflow用户

发布于 2017-04-01 21:19:40

我会放弃中位数,这是相当困难的计算。相反,我建议计算平均

代码语言:javascript
复制
SELECT iml.Item_Name, iml.NPC_Item_Price, iml.NPC_Item_Value,   
       MAX(vs.Sales_Total_Price),    
       MIN(vs.Sales_Total_Price),
       AVG(vs.Sales_Total_Price)       
FROM item_master_list iml INNER JOIN
     public_vendor_sales_data vs
     ON vs.Item_ID = iml.Item_ID
GROUP BY Item_Name;
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/43162126

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档